From: Human antibodies targeting the C-type lectin-like domain of the tumor endothelial cell marker clec14a regulate angiogenic properties in vitro

Figure 1

Effect of clec14a-CTLD in cell migration. (a) Schematic representation of GFP, clec14a-GFP and clec14aΔCTLD-GFP. (b) Lysates of COS-7 cells transfected with GFP, clec14a-GFP or clec14aΔCTLD-GFP were analyzed by immunoblotting with anti-GFP or anti-β-actin antibodies. (c) Migration of COS-7 cells transfected with GFP, clec14a-GFP or clec14aΔCTLD-GFP in the wound healing assay was monitored under a light microscope. Images were captured at 0 h (top) and 20 h (bottom). (d) Distance migrated is expressed as percent of control migration. Values represent mean±s.d. of triplicate measurements from one of three independent experiments.
